Day trip from Venlo to Maastricht

Why visit Maastricht for the day?

Maastricht is known for its Roman past, medieval churches and graceful squares in the far south of the Netherlands. Split by the River Maas, it has a warm, Burgundian feel shaped by Dutch, Belgian and German influences.

Day trip from Venlo to Eindhoven

Why visit Eindhoven for the day?

Eindhoven is known for design, technology and its Philips past, giving it a modern, creative feel. Former industrial areas, contemporary architecture and a lively student scene shape the city’s character.

Day trip from Venlo to Nijmegen

Why visit Nijmegen for the day?

Nijmegen is the Netherlands' oldest city, known for Roman history, a lively student scene and its setting on the River Waal. Historic streets, green parks and busy cafés give it an easy-going character.

Day trip from Venlo to Mönchengladbach

Why visit Mönchengladbach for the day?

Mönchengladbach is best known for Borussia Mönchengladbach and its roots in the textile industry. Parks, Schloss Rheydt and a practical Rhineland atmosphere give the city a grounded, everyday character.

Day trip from Venlo to Roermond

Why visit Roermond for the day?

Roermond is a compact Limburg city known for its designer outlet, historic centre and waterside setting. Gothic churches, pleasant squares and the nearby Maasplassen give it a relaxed mix of shopping, culture and outdoor life.
